Cleveland Cavaliers Betting Preview
The Cavs have won their last eight games, where the streak began after losing to the Celtics on February 4th. Their recent success was a 122-82 blowout over the Orlando Magic.
Cleveland, surprisingly, was only listed as 6.5-point favorites. The Magic have been struggling trying to stay above .500, and it showed here on both ends of the court. Ty Jerome led with 20 points off the bench and five players total reached double figures.
Orlando connected on 36.7 percent of their shots and were held to just 17.9 percent shooting from three point range. Cleveland did an excellent job sharing the rock with 25 assists, which led to 56.3 percent shooting from the field and 59.4 percent from deep.
The Cavs currently rank second in the league in scoring with 122.9 points per game. Their defense is also appealing at allowing opponents to get 111.2 points each game, ranking 10th. This ranks them second overall in their differential per game.

Boston Celtics Betting Preview
The Celtics just had their six-game win streak snapped with a 117-97 blowout loss against the Detroit Pistons. This was their second worst loss of the season, going back a month ago against the Los Angeles Lakers.
Boston had a few moments in this game where they could have taken a lead and potentially sustained it. However, those moments never panned out. Jayson Tatum led with 27 points and Al Horford led with 10 rebounds.
Detroit led with 52.8 percent shooting from the field while connecting on 39.4 percent from deep. Boston made 41.3 percent of their shots overall and 42.9 percent from three point territory. The Celtics did not win in several categories such as rebounding, as the little things caught up to them.
The Celtics are sixth in the league for producing 116.9 points per contest. On defense, they rank third in holding teams to 108.1 points each matchup. This ranks third overall in point differential.
